To encourage a grillin' good time, the propane tank specialists at Blue Rhino company partnered with iTunes to create a &#x22;Music to Grill By&#x22; playlist based on a consumer poll. Blue Rhino conducted the 2007 Official Grilling Man and Grilling Woman Surveys asking more than 2,000 people in the &#x22;continental U.S. and Canada&#x22; to name their favorite grilling song. <description> (Photo courtesy of Lesley Frowick from NationalGeographic.com) Cherry blossoms are abundantly in bloom along the Tidal Basin in Washington, D.C. The blooming of the pink and white blossoms heralds spring's arrival in the nation's capital, where hundreds of thousands of visitors flock each year to visit the National Cherry Blossom Festival.Maintaining the 3,000-plus cherry trees is a big job for the National Park Service.
